Compare all specifications:
1954 Singer Hunter | 2010 Acura TSX | |
Make | Singer | Acura |
Model | Hunter | TSX |
Year Released | 1954 | 2010 |
Engine Size | 1497 cc | 2400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 47 HP | 201 HP |
Engine RPM | 4500 RPM | 7000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 1140 kg | 1542 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4420 mm | 4714 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1610 mm | 1839 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1630 mm | 1438 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2180 mm | 2708 mm |
